Output 43e834d1ff901de8ff6ce0d8ac386ed583df555db8f1fd6504b7f195643a2c34:0

value
1508711600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805b25c9d88b0b7e86131c82ba0c6331ce7709a5 OP_EQUAL
address
3DPhc9NMwuhN7ZweuSfsg6QZVbDnSRo8as
transaction
43e834d1ff901de8ff6ce0d8ac386ed583df555db8f1fd6504b7f195643a2c34
spent
true